Transit Time Monitoring
Become an expert on the topic with us, build your EN 13850 / EN 14534 certified
monitoring system and improve controls for your operations.
Universal services are basic communication services that, according to European universal service rules,
must remain affordable and of reasonable quality so that everyone can use them and to ensure fairness of
intercountry delivery for service providers.
Mail delivery falls under the category of universal services, making it subject to complex European standards.
Many factors must be taken into consideration during measurement planning to ensure compliant results:
EU members are obligated to measure according to European standards
Spectos is specialized in EN 13850 (single-piece mail) and EN 14534 (bulk mail)
Measurement must be conducted by an independent, external organization
Responsible organizations can be audited by country-specific authorities

Structured approach for high quality production
Test mail for measurements is produced at Spectos’ central production facility and according to the data
produced during planning with the in-house developed operational system, SpectosLab.
The range of test mail Spectos produces varies from test items for simple bulk mail measurements with one
sender, to more complex fields of study with 3 to 150 private and/or company senders, different drop dates,
mail formats (standard/large letters, small packages) and franking types.
International facilities support production goals
Spectos has extensive experience in the international postal industry and has achieved optimal results with
opening offices in the country in which the client is located to organizational, telephone, and distribution
support.

Data collection in new, modern & fun to use form
Mailagenten, a Spectos in-house development, is a web portal dedicated
solely to the electronic data collection for transit time measurements. The
application acts as a communication portal for hundreds of thousands of
panelists.
Every panelist receives an individual account via email
Use of I.Codes for receiver verification, bundle codes for senders verification
Regular email reminders to verify receipt/non-receipt of test letters
Overview of past, current and upcoming test letters to inform and prepare panelists
Integration of panelist incentive program (Spectos Cents) for long-term panelist motivation
Multi-language interface translated by native speakers
Added accessibility for panelists - web application is available 24/7

Tracking Logistical Processes
Constant knowledge – end to end
RFID tags, comprised of a tiny chip and a flat antenna, are attached to items and
goods which are monitored by reading devices installed along the time-sensitive
logistic chain, making RFID readings a beneficial source of information for transit
time measurements.
Better insight into delivery routes, processes, punctuality for added daily transparency
Collaboration with third party suppliers, such as Lyngsoe and Identec
Flexible, small design for indistinguishable placement in test mail
Tags can be read without direct contact, making them more effective than barcodes which
become unreadable easily
RFID tags are read by large gates placed at crucial measuring points (ex. entrances and
exits), and also by small reading devices placed in panelists’ mailboxes
Passive and active RFID tags are used to track goods of different volumes, including:
individual items, unaddressed catalogues, bulk mail, entire pallets, large packages, etc.
Captured data is used for internal panel quality control through Spectos

Reviewing Each Panelist’s Responses
Each sender and receiver’s performance is individually reviewed according to defined KPIs on a weekly basis to assure panel
quality.
Review accessibility/availability of study participants
Assess the panelist’s motivation to participate in further Spectos studies
The reliability and consistency of the panelist’s responses regarding drop/receipt date and transit times
Panelists whose responses seem conspicuous are contacted and checked case-by-case to determine next steps, including
deactivation.
The goal of this process is to identify and retrain panelists with longer transit times than average or low amount of on-time
deliveries. Certain steps are undertaken to determine questionable panelists
Assurance of Panel Quality
